Singular spin-flip interactions for the 1D Schr\"{o}dinger operator

Abstract

We consider singular self-adjoint extensions for one-dimensional Schr\"{o}dinger operator for two-component wave function within the framework of the distribution theory for discontinuous test functions \cite{funcan_deltadistr_kurasov_jmathan1996}. We show that among \mathdsC4\mathds{C}^{4}-parameter set of boundary conditions with state mixing there is only \mathdsR2\mathds{R}^2-parameter subset compatible with the spin interpretation of the two-component structure of the wave function. For the spin interpretation of such wave function they can be identified as the point-like spin-momentum (Rashba) interactions. We suggest their physical realizations based on the regularized form of the Hamiltonian which couples the electrical field inhomogeneity to spin.
